Carol Ann Worman, age 87, of Columbus, Ohio, passed away peacefully on June 20, 2025. Born on February 12, 1938, in Wilmington, Ohio, she was cherished by all who knew her and leaves behind a legacy of kindness and joy.

Carol was the beloved daughter of the late Herbert and Helen "Lucille" Spencer. Her loving spirit was greatly influenced by her early years, surrounded by family and the values instilled in her by her parents. She was preceded in death by her sister, Marilyn Jones, and her nephew, Craig Jones, who both played significant roles in her life. Their memories remain etched in the hearts of those who knew her.

Carol is lovingly survived by her sister, Kay (Ken) Adams. She took great pride in her family, particularly in her nieces, Wendy (Mitch) Jones and Terri (Mike) Dennewitz, who brought her endless joy and laughter. The love she had for her great-nieces—Amber (Darren) Johnson, Kristin (Craig) Mast, Ashley Winters, Monica Dennewitz, and Jacqueline (Jeremy) Lovitt—as well as her great-nephew, Sean Adams, was immeasurable.

Carol's bond with her lifelong best friend, Emily Madden, showcased the deep connections she fostered throughout her life. Their friendship was a testament to her loyalty and devotion, as they shared countless memories filled with laughter and love.

Known for her fun-loving and hard-working nature, Carol embraced life with open arms. She had an infectious personality, always ready to share kindness with those around her. Her generosity of spirit shone brightly in every interaction, and she had a unique ability to find humor in the mundane, bringing smiles to many faces. With a deep appreciation for all things that sparkled and glittered, she injected a little bit of magic into everyday life.

As we reflect on her vibrant existence, we remember a woman who loved deeply and lived fully. Carol will be deeply missed by her family and friends, whose lives she touched with her warmth and wit.

Per Carol's wishes, a dignified cremation will take place at Newcomer Funeral Home, honoring her spirit and the memories she leaves behind.
